
WWEs post-WrestleMania trimming spree just claimed another pair of familiar facesthis time its former Womens Tag Team Champions Katana Chance and Kayden Carter. According to Fightful Select, both Superstars were quietly released as part of the ongoing wave of talent cuts hitting the company this week.
Katana and Kayden were among WWEs most consistent tag teams in recent years. After grinding through NXT for several years, the duo finally captured the NXT Womens Tag Team Titles in 2022 and held them for a record-setting run. Their chemistry, energy, and in-ring style made them fan favorites and fixtures on the black-and-gold brand.
In 2023, they were called up to the main roster and brought their electric tandem offense to RAW, where they eventually captured the WWE Womens Tag Team Championships from Chelsea Green and Piper Niven in late 2023. Despite their momentum, they were often underutilized in the tag division, which has struggled with consistent booking across the board.
Their release is part of a growing list of cuts that includes Braun Strowman and Shayna Baszlershowing that even recent champions and active performers arent immune from WWEs quiet restructuring under the TKO Group.
WWE has not publicly confirmed the news, and no statement has been made by either Chance or Carter as of now.
